diff --git a/MBL/source_ns/CMakeLists.txt b/MBL/source_ns/CMakeLists.txt index bc2fe48..971119c 100644 --- a/MBL/source_ns/CMakeLists.txt +++ b/MBL/source_ns/CMakeLists.txt @@ -1,5 +1,5 @@ - cmake_minimum_required(VERSION 3.15) + set(TARGET_EXE mbl-ns) set(TAGET_PROJECT_DIR ${PROJECT_SOURCE_DIR}/MBL/Project) add_executable(${TARGET_EXE}) @@ -25,7 +25,27 @@ target_sources(${TARGET_EXE} mbl_qspi_flash.c mbl_sys.c mbl_uart.c - ) + drivers/CMT2310/0_Project/Uart_PingPong/main.c + dr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_callback.c + dr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_core.c + dr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_port.c + drivers/CMT2310/0_Project/Uart_PingPong/irq_handle.c + drivers/CMT2310/1_Middleware/Kfifo/ebyte_kfifo.c + drivers/CMT2310/1_Middleware/Produce/ebyte_debug.c + drivers/CMT2310/2_Ebyte_Board_Support/E15-EVB02/board_button.c + drivers/CMT2310/2_Ebyte_Board_Support/E15-EVB02/board_mini_printf.c + drivers/CMT2310/2_Ebyte_Board_Support/E15-EVB02/board.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/cmt2310a_433mhz.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/radio.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/cmt2310a_868mhz.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/cmt2310a_915mhz.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/radio_phy.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/radio_hal.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/cmt2310a_410mhz.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/radio_mac.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/radio_spi.c + dr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/ebyte_e48x.c +) target_sources(${TARGET_EXE} PRIVATE @@ -48,6 +68,12 @@ target_sources(${TARGET_EXE} target_include_directories(${TARGET_EXE} PRIVATE ${PROJECT_SOURCE_DIR}/NSPE/Firmware/GD32W51x_standard_peripheral/Include +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/0_Project/Uart_PingPong/ +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/1_Middleware/Kfifo/ +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/1_Middleware/Produce/ +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/2_Ebyte_Board_Support/E15-EVB02/ + ${CMAKE_CURRENT_SOURCE_DIR}/drivers/CMT2310/3_Ebyte_WirelessModule_Drivers/E48xMx/ ) target_add_scatter_file(${TARGET_EXE} diff --git a/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_port.c b/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_port.c index 61f173f..f3ac1d4 100755 --- a/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_port.c +++ b/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/ebyte/ebyte_port.c @@ -23,7 +23,6 @@ /*= !!!配置目标硬件平台头文件 =======================================*/ #include "board.h" //E15-EVB02 评估板 -#include "wrapper_os.h" /*==================================================================*/ /* ! diff --git a/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/main.c b/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/main.c index 508bf42..e244093 100755 --- a/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/main.c +++ b/MBL/source_ns/drivers/CMT2310/0_Project/Uart_PingPong/main.c @@ -22,8 +22,6 @@ #include "ebyte_core.h" #include "ebyte_kfifo.h" #include "ebyte_debug.h" -#include "wrapper_os.h" -#include "debug_print.h" void Task_Transmit( void ); void Task_Button( void );